WASHINGTON, Sept. 19 -- The following federal contracts were announced by federal agencies as having been awarded to companies operating in California.
CURTIN MARITIME, Long Beach, California, won a federal contract award for $11,471,704 from the U.S. Army, Wilmington, North Carolina, for other heavy and civil engineering construction.
